Subject: Key rotation for SlimForge pipeline

Hi — welcome aboard. As part of our quarterly rotation, the credentials for SlimForge, our container image slimming service, were cycled this morning. The old key stops working Friday at noon. Builds through the Verrick pipeline will fail with a 401 until you update your local config. Please swap it in before your next image build. Your new key is below.

app token of tadug-yahag = vxb3-949

Ticket #RT-2281 — Vault locked after telemetry compression rollout. Hey plugin authors: the Glimwire vault auto-locked when we switched payloads to zstd, so signed uploads are bouncing. Keep compressing on your end; we'll re-open ingestion once the vault is unsealed. To unseal locally for testing, use the recovery passphrase below.

unlock words, hahip-yagef: zorok-novmir-zorix-silax

Subject: Gatecount cut-over summary

Welcome aboard — on Saturday we moved the Thornmead Stadium turnstile counter, Gatecount, from the on-prem tally boxes to the hosted aggregator. All 64 lanes reported within two minutes of first scan, and reconciliation against manual clickers matched within 0.3%. Lane 41's flaky sensor was replaced pre-event. The service now runs with the following values.

config for hahip-kaguf:
[holath]
port = 8443
region = north-4
host = holath.tolvaqlabs.internal
timeout_ms = 1000
retries = 2

Facilities Ticket — Cleaning Crew Access, Brindle Annex

For new starters handling evening lock-up: the Sorano Cleaning crew arrives nightly at 21:30 via the annex side door. Check their rota sheet, note arrival in the log, and ensure the storeroom is relocked afterward. To let them through the side door, enter the access code below.

badge for yaweg-hafog: bdg-GX-6